St. Marks children & youth have been working hard since September to bring you a lively production of “The Storytellin’ Man”.
Based on a script by Ken Medema and customized for us by Alannah Hegedus, the light-hearted musical tells the story of three of Jesus’ parables. Directed by Sara Wahl.
Featuring the Worship Band & the Back Porch Jug Band!
